What are the best and worst parts of working in radio in the Triad?

0
10

Kelly: Well, the hours aren’t great. You have to get up very early. That’s probably one of the worst parts of it. … I’m tired a lot. James: Sometimes people dismiss this area and we don’t really get opportunities to speak to bigger names and they don’t usually come through this way Kelly: That is so true. We’ve tried to get interviews with people on the show that will do a station in Charlotte and they just will not do it here. I think we’re just out of that realm. James: They’re missing out, though. Kelly: As far as positives … Well, it’s nice to meet the listeners. James: We get a lot of support and a lot of love from the community. Every time we do something our listeners do show up. Demm: As clichéd as it sounds, it’s really what I’ve always thought would be a fun way to make a living. James: If I could change one thing I would like a breakfast bar.
